Key Cultural Festivals in Yaoundé

1. Fête de la Musique (Music Festival)

Fête de la Musique

The Fête de la Musique, celebrated annually on June 21st, is a vibrant music festival that takes place in various cities across Cameroon, with Yaoundé being a focal point. This festival is a celebration of music in all its forms, featuring local artists, bands, and musicians from different genres.

What to Expect: - Live performances in parks, streets, and public squares. - A mix of traditional and contemporary music styles. - Opportunities to dance and engage with local artists.

2. Festival International de Jazz de Yaoundé

Festival International de Jazz de Yaoundé

Jazz enthusiasts will find a home at the Festival International de Jazz de Yaoundé, usually held in December. This festival attracts both local and international jazz musicians, creating a melting pot of musical styles and influences.

What to Expect: - Concerts featuring renowned jazz artists. - Workshops and masterclasses for aspiring musicians. - A lively atmosphere filled with rhythm and creativity.

3. Ngondo Festival

Ngondo Festival

The Ngondo Festival is a significant cultural event for the Sawa people of the Littoral region, celebrated in Yaoundé. This festival, which typically occurs in early December, honors the ancestors and showcases the rich traditions of the Sawa community.

What to Expect: - Traditional dances, music, and storytelling. - Rituals and ceremonies honoring ancestors. - A vibrant display of traditional attire and crafts.

4. Festival des Arts et de la Culture (FAC)

Festival des Arts et de la Culture

The Festival des Arts et de la Culture is an annual event that celebrates the artistic diversity of Cameroon. This festival features a wide range of artistic expressions, including visual arts, theater, dance, and literature.

What to Expect: - Art exhibitions showcasing local artists. - Performances by theater groups and dance troupes. - Workshops and discussions on various cultural topics.

5. Carnaval de Yaoundé

Carnaval de Yaoundé

The Carnaval de Yaoundé is a lively celebration that takes place in February, marking the beginning of the carnival season. This festival is characterized by colorful parades, music, and dance, reflecting the joyous spirit of the city.

What to Expect: - Grand parades featuring floats and costumes. - Street performances and live music. - A festive atmosphere with food stalls and local delicacies.

Best Time to Visit Yaoundé

The best time to visit Yaoundé is during the dry season, which runs from November to February. During these months, the weather is pleasant, with lower humidity and minimal rainfall. The average temperature ranges from 20°C to 30°C (68°F to 86°F), making it ideal for outdoor activities and festival participation.

Weather Information

  • November to February: Dry season, cooler temperatures.
  • March to October: Rainy season, higher humidity, and occasional thunderstorms.
